大战 (dà zhàn) — large-scale war or battle; fierce competition (figurative)
Definition
大战 (dàzhàn) literally means 'great battle' and is used for both real large-scale wars (世界大战) and figurative fierce contests (价格大战 'price war'). It is a noun, not a verb — use 打仗 or 作战 for the verb 'to fight a war'.
noun
large-scale war or battlefierce competition (figurative)
Measure word · 场
